H.R. 9224

BillFederalHouseIn Committee
To amend the Consumer Credit Protection Act to address restrictions on the garnishment of wages, prohibitions on debt collection practices relating to imprisonment of debtors, and for other purposes.

Protecting Wages of Essential Workers Act of 2022 This bill expands the federal restriction on the garnishment of wages to protect from any garnishment the first $1,000 of an individual's weekly disposable earnings.
